How to Apply (and Remove) Peel-and-Stick Wallpaper the Right Way

This guide provides detailed instructions on how to apply and remove peel-and-stick wallpaper, offering an easy way to refresh home interiors. The article emphasizes proper preparation and application techniques to achieve a professional finish. Before beginning, it is crucial to gather necessary tools, including peel-and-stick wallpaper, a tape measure, level, sharp scissors or utility knife, a plastic squeegee, pencil, and a damp cloth. The first step involves thoroughly cleaning the wall surface, ensuring it is flat, even, and free of dust or debris. Interior designer Emily Shaw recommends wiping walls with mild detergent and water or a microfiber cloth. Any textural imperfections, such as holes or bumps, should be patched with drywall spackling paste and sanded smooth to prevent them from showing through the wallpaper. It is also advised to order about 10% more wallpaper than initially estimated to account for errors or complex areas. The next critical step is to accurately measure the width and height of the wall to determine the number of wallpaper panels needed and to ensure proper pattern alignment. Professional installer Yamil Asis suggests using a level to mark light pencil guidelines, which helps in applying the first strip straight. These marks should be minimal as they can sometimes show through lighter peel-and-stick papers. The application process begins at an upper corner, typically the upper left. Rachel Mae Smith, DIY blogger and author, stresses the importance of precise placement for the first panel, recommending taking ample time and using a level. Only a small section of the backing should be removed at a time, starting from the top. As the backing is peeled, the wallpaper should be smoothed downwards with a squeegee or plastic card, working from the center outwards to push out air bubbles. The adhesive nature of peel-and-stick wallpaper allows for re-adjustment if necessary. Clean hands or cloth-covered hands are advised to prevent transferring grease or dirt to the paper. After applying the first panel, any excess wallpaper at the ceiling and baseboards should be trimmed using a box cutter or utility knife. For subsequent panels, painter's tape can be used to align the pattern with the previously installed panel, which expedites the process. Working in small increments, such as 12 to 20 inches, helps maintain control and consistent alignment. When encountering obstacles like outlets and windows, outlet cover plates should be removed. A small hole can be cut in the wallpaper over the outlet's center, then the paper laid flat, and finally, the area trimmed with a box cutter before replacing the cover. For windows, a laser level ensures straight lines, and overhangs are trimmed with a sharp utility knife. Should air bubbles persist after application, a small tool, like a Cricut Weeding tool, can be used to prick a tiny hole in the bubble, followed by smoothing with a card or squeegee to make it disappear. Metal cards are generally discouraged for smoothing as they can damage certain wallpaper brands. For removal, warm water or a mild soapy solution can soften the adhesive. If the wallpaper remains stubborn, products like EZ Hang Peel & Stick Activator or heat from a blow-dryer or steamer can help loosen the glue. The wallpaper should be peeled slowly at an angle, starting from a corner. High-quality peel-and-stick wallpaper typically comes off in large sections with minimal residue. After removal, walls should be cleaned with a mild solution, avoiding harsh chemicals, and checked for any necessary touch-ups or filler.
